Mike Ribeiro (born February 10, 1980, in Montreal, Quebec, Canada) is a professional ice hockey player of Portuguese ancestry, now playing for the Dallas Stars of the National Hockey League. Ribeiro, who is a natural centre, was drafted 45th overall by the Montreal Canadiens in the 2nd round of the 1998 NHL Entry Draft. On September 30, 2006, the Canadiens traded Ribeiro and a 6th round draft pick in 2008 to the Dallas Stars, in exchange for Janne Niinimaa and a 5th round draft pick in 2007. Career in DallasDuring the 2006–07 season he led the Dallas Stars in points scoring with 59 points. On July 12th, The Dallas Stars signed Ribeiro to a one year contract worth 2.8 million dollars. On January 7th, 2008, Ribeiro and the Stars agreed to a new five-year contract worth $25 million, which should keep him in Dallas until the 2012–2013 season. Later that same month, Ribeiro represented the Dallas Stars in his first NHL All-Star game. Ribeiro is known for his creative style of play, with between-the-leg passes, patient puck-handling, and his ability to set up other players.
